Navy medic searches for missing poodle after AirTag found without dog

CAMDEN, N.J. (WPVI) -- A U.S. Navy medic is pleading for help to find her missing toy apricot poodle after the dog disappeared in Camden two weeks ago.

The search for the five-pound dog, named Noelle, has taken a confusing turn after her AirTag was recovered with no sign of the animal.

Jessica Lora, who is stationed in upstate New York, said Noelle serves as her support animal following an atopic pregnancy. Lora said the AirTag had been firmly attached.

"It was pretty secure in her harness, so I don't think that it just naturally came off," she said. "I genuinely feel like someone may have removed it."

Lora said her mother had been dog-sitting and brought Noelle to South Jersey to visit family.

The dog somehow got out of the yard, prompting relatives to search Camden and Pennsauken, review surveillance video and distribute flyers with help from a nonprofit rescue group.

Kathy TortuBowles of Bailey's Bridge to Home Rescue and Recovery in Cherry Hill said the group has been following up on tips.

"We did get a couple of leads last week. There were two people that said the same thing about a dog down on 26th Street in Camden, so we flooded that area with flyers," she said.

The nonprofit is offering a $1,500 reward as the search continues.
